Anyone recognise the two-seater turqoise trike with the centre joystick? My money's on it being a Porquerolles. One electric motor powering each rear wheel and a castor-type front wheel.
As for the glass and ally cube - Quasar? Mini-based concept from the sixties. Not many survivors (oddly enough) but I know of one in Toulouse in the care of a serious microcar enthusiast.
